info_outlineIn this episode, I have a question for you to ask yourself. Are you waiting for everything to be perfect, to be lined up perfectly until you decide to stand in your light? Are you waiting to release the podcast, do the live, share your story, write the chapter, the book, speak from stage, or launch your program when it is done and perfect? That is never going to happen and you will be waiting a long time before you can release it. More importantly you are missing incredible opportunities, people and experiences because they won’t see you for who you truly are.
In this episode, we discuss:
1) Who do you connect with, relate to, learn from? Do you resonate and relate to them because they are perfect or because they are real?
2) Shine in your imperfections, in your pieces of fear of judgment and show others you are human. Call out your fears first, I did this years ago when I was sharing my own vulnerable story in a book.
3) Where is one place you can challenge yourself to shine before you are ready? Can you show up on a video without being ready, can you put the post out without checking it 198 times?
When you step forward you learn, you might have a misstep but it isn’t a failure, failure is an event it is not a person or an identity. Stand in your own light, and shine a light on everything that is not perfect, that is what will make you the most relatable.

Marsha Vanwynsberghe — Author, Speaker, and Life Coach
Marsha is the 6-time Bestselling Author of “When She Stopped Asking Why”. She shares her lessons as a parent who dealt with teen substance abuse far past the level of normal experimentation.
Through her programs, coaching, and live events for women, Marsha is on a mission to teach you how to “Own Your Choices” in your own life. She teaches women how to own their stories, lead themselves and pay it forward to others by creating businesses that serve, support, and impact others.
